Rafael Nadal set to get ‘very big’ retirement ceremony 200 days after quitting tennis

The tennis world is abuzz with news that Rafael Nadal, the legendary 14-time French Open champion, is set to receive a “very big” retirement ceremony at Roland Garros, approximately 200 days after his official departure from professional tennis. This announcement comes after some controversy surrounding the perceived lack of a fitting farewell at the Davis Cup Finals last November.

Here’s a breakdown of the developing story:

  • The Planned Tribute:
    • The French Tennis Federation has confirmed that a significant tribute to Nadal’s illustrious career will take place during this year’s French Open.  
    • French Tennis Federation president Gilles Moretton has stated that it will be a “real tribute, very important,” emphasizing the deep connection between Nadal and Roland Garros.  
    • The planning for this ceremony has been in progress for some time, with officials even visiting Nadal to discuss the details.
  • Addressing Past Concerns:
    • Nadal’s retirement at the Davis Cup Finals in Malaga was met with mixed reactions, with some, including members of his own team, expressing disappointment in the perceived lack of grandeur.
    • Comments from figures like Nadal’s uncle, Toni Nadal, showed that the initial retirement ceremony was considered to be “not up to par.”
    • There where also comments from other tennis greats, like Novak Djokovic, who felt that the retirement was not done properly.  
    • The french open tribute looks to rectify those feelings.
  • Nadal’s Connection to Roland Garros:
    • Roland Garros holds a special place in Nadal’s heart, having won the French Open title a record 14 times.  
    • The “King of Clay” has an almost unparalleled legacy at the tournament, making it the perfect venue for his official retirement celebration.
    • It has been stated that “The two ‘brands’, Rafael Nadal and Roland-Garros, are one.”
  • What to Expect:
    • While specific details of the ceremony are still emerging, it is expected to be a grand affair, reflecting Nadal’s immense contribution to tennis.
